About K12 Inc.

K12 Inc. (NYSE: LRN), a technology-based education company, is the largest provider of proprietary curriculum and online education programs for students in kindergarten through high school in the U.S. K12 provides its curriculum and academic services to public and private online schools, traditional classrooms, blended school programs, and directly to families. K12 also operates the K12 International AcademyTM, an accredited, diploma-granting online private school.

Founded in 2000, K12 has provided over 2 million courses - core subjects, AP®, world languages, credit recovery, and electives - to more than 200,000 students worldwide. Over 90 percent of parents surveyed are satisfied with the K12 program and agree that their children have benefited academically with K12. Students graduating from K12 virtual schools have been accepted to hundreds of higher education institutions including many of the nation's top-ranked colleges and universities.

In April 2010, K12 joined with Middlebury College to form a new venture called Middlebury Interactive Languages to create and distribute innovative online language courses for pre-college students. In July 2010, K12 acquired KC Distance Learning, Inc., a nationally recognized leader in online learning with brands that provide high quality education products and online school solutions: Aventa LearningTM, The KeystoneTM School and iQ Academies®. In November, K12 acquired American Education Corporation, a leading provider of instructional and assessment software for kindergarten through adult learners. In the same month, K12 also announced a strategic investment to acquire a minority interest in Web International English, a leader in English language training for thousands of students in China.

K12 is accredited through AdvancED, the world's largest education community. More information on K12 can be found at: www.K12.com
